New Club Executive Branch Offers Wealthy Access to Trump Administration

Executive Branch is the name of a new club for the really wealthy who want to get close to the Trump administration to do business. Founder: Donald Trump junior, the son.

The new club's activities have started in silence, but are revealed by Politico.

According to the American news site, the idea is to create the most luxurious private membership club ever seen in Washington DC. For a half million dollar entrance fee, eager businessmen and donors will in return get access to influential people in the Trump sphere, including high-ranking individuals in the president's administration.

The high membership fee and secrecy are intended to keep the inquiring press at bay, but also ensure that only the really wealthy individuals can join.

The mastermind behind Executive Branch is the president's eldest son and namesake Donald Trump and Omeed Malik, a venture capitalist who has long supported President Trump and other right-wing politicians.

Neither Donald Trump the younger nor Omeed Malik have wanted to comment on the reports about the new club.

Donald Trump has no formal position in the White House or the Trump administration, but plays an important role in the family business Trump Organization and often acts on behalf of his father. Among other things, the president's son visited Greenland in January after his father announced that he intended to make the Danish island American.
